Dowling to co-present SM:TV Live
Published Friday, Jan 4 2002, 14:13 GMT | By Neil Wilkes
Brian Dowling, winner of Channel 4's Big Brother 2, has signed a deal to front SM:TV Live, according to a report in The Sun today.
The contract, worth £500 per show, will see him join the new presenter lineup from tomorrow morning, doing celebrity interviews and comedy sketches.
Dowling said: “I’m absolutely thrilled. I can’t believe I’m working on a programme I have watched for so long. I’m even looking forward to the early mornings.???
A spokesman said: “Brian was fantastic when he hosted SM:TV at Christmas. He had great feedback from the kids in the studio and we’ve had loads of e-mails and letters from viewers saying how much they love him.???
Dowling joins another new face to SM:TV - model Tess Daly, who also begins tomorrow morning.
